Given the amount of literary and mythological references in Hozier’s lyrics, this is bound to be far from his last appearance here. In Sunlight, I appreciate his spin on the Icarus myth. The singer is magnetically drawn to someone like a moth to a flame. The verse that mentions Icarus depicts him as a willing lover of the sun, as opposed to other stories where he’s portrayed as a reckless youth who doesn’t know better when he flies too high. Is Hozier suggesting that Icarus and Helios had a little something going on? Or is he just reframing the myth for the sake of a cozy metaphor?
